    Hi my husband my 4 year old daughter and I will be going to WDW on 11/27 thru 12/3. We are very excited and I already started booking the dining reservations and I was wondering if 1-2 reservations 3 reservations for each day are too much? Please help me

    Hi Maria! Congratulations on your upcoming Walt Disney World Resort vacation! Personally, I don't consider two Advanced Dining Reservations (ADR) per day to be excessive at all. I typically book breakfast or lunch, then dinner daily. Don't forget to reserve a couple of Disney Character Dining experiences. To read more about my family's favorite restaurants go HERE. You may book ADR by calling (407) WDW-DINE or online. Please let me know if I can answer any other questions for you. Have a memorable visit to the Walt Disney World Resort!
